The Ant-y Origins of Yogurt Making
Fermenting milk is as old as time—well, almost. Different cultures have their own quirky methods, often passed down through generations. Take Bulgaria, for instance, where the forests are crawling with red wood ants. These little critters aren’t just for picnics; they’re part of a traditional yogurt-making secret that scientists have recently uncovered. According to a study published in iScience, dropping a few ants (or their eggs) into milk kick-starts fermentation. This isn’t just folklore; it’s a culinary marvel that’s stood the test of time.
The researchers didn’t just stop at ants. They teamed up with chefs to create modern recipes using this ant-infused yogurt. Co-author Leonie Jahn from the Technical University of Denmark pointed out that today’s commercial yogurts are usually made with just two bacterial strains. Traditional methods, on the other hand, boast a biodiversity that varies by location and season, offering a rich tapestry of flavors and textures. From the Forest to Your Fridge: The Making of Ant Yogurt
To truly understand traditional culinary methods, you have to go back to where it all began. For this study, that meant heading to Nova Mahala, Bulgaria, where co-author Sevgi Mutlu Sirakova’s family still resides. With guidance from Sirakova’s uncle, the team set out to recreate the region’s ant yogurt. They started with fresh raw cow milk, heated until it was hot enough to ‘bite your pinkie finger.’ Then came the pièce de résistance: four live red wood ants, plucked from a local colony and added to the milk.
The process didn’t end there. The milk was covered with cheesecloth, wrapped in fabric for insulation, and then buried inside an ant colony. Yes, you read that right—buried. The nest itself generates heat, acting as a natural incubator for yogurt fermentation. After 26 hours, the team retrieved the container, eager to taste the concoction. The result? A thick, slightly tangy yogurt with herbaceous notes and a hint of ‘grass-fed fat.’
The Science Behind the Ant-y Alchemy
So, what’s the science behind this ant-y alchemy? It turns out that the ants introduce a variety of bacteria and yeasts into the milk, which are crucial for fermentation. This biodiversity is what gives traditional yogurts their unique flavors and textures. While modern yogurt production relies on controlled environments and specific bacterial strains, the traditional method embraces the chaos of nature, resulting in a more complex taste profile.
